7 Gramercy Park is a grand prewar building constructed in 1913 and converted to 25 renovated luxury apartments by architect Rafael Vinoly in 1986. Today, it stands as one of just two full-service doorman condominiums on the park. Residents of the elevator building enjoy 24-hour doorman service, a live-in superintendent, laundry and a coveted key to the park. Sorry, no pets.
